Microwave Peach Butter

I often make this quick and easy recipe it can even be made ahead of time and frozen. For gift-giving, I decorate the jar lids with Christmas fabric, lace and ribbons. 64 ServingsPrep/Total Time: 30 min.
Ingredients
- 4 cans (15-1/4 ounces each) peach halves or sliced peaches, drained
- 1 package (1-3/4 ounces) powdered fruit pectin
- 1-1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
- 1/2 teaspoon ground allspice
- 4-1/2 cups sugar
Directions
- Place peaches in a food processor or blender; process until smooth.
- In a large microwave-safe bowl, combine the peaches, pectin,
- cinnamon and allspice. Cover with waxed paper and microwave on high
- for 4-5 minutes or until mixture just begins to bubble, stirring
- every minute.
- Stir in sugar; microwave on high for 5-6 minutes or until mixture
- comes to a rolling boil, stirring after 3 minutes. Microwave on high
- for 30 seconds. Pour hot into hot jars or freezer containers,
- leaving 1/2-in. headspace. Cool slightly.
- Cover with tight-fitting lids. Refrigerate or freeze. May be
- refrigerated for 3 weeks or frozen up to 3 months. Yield: 8
- half-pints.
